BINGHAM v. STATE

No. 97-KA-00538 COA.

723 So.2d 1189 (1998)

Derrick BINGHAM, Appellant, v. STATE of Mississippi, Appellee.

Court of Appeals of Mississippi.

November 24, 1998.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lee B. Agnew, Jr., Kate S. Eidt, Jackson, Attorneys for Appellant.

Office of the Attorney General by Jean Smith Vaughan, Attorneys for Appellee.

BEFORE THOMAS, P.J., DIAZ, AND SOUTHWICK, JJ.


THOMAS, P.J., for the Court:

¶ 1. Derrick Bingham appeals his conviction of aggravated assault raising the following issues as error:

I. WHETHER THE COURT ERRED IN PROHIBITING TESTIMONY OF A DEFENSE WITNESS DIRECTLY CONTRADICTING THE TESTIMONY OF THE STATE'S WITNESS CALLING INTO QUESTION THE CREDIBILITY AND VERACITY OF THE STATE'S WITNESS.
